Does anyone know anything about doing an HID headlight conversion on these trucks, or what companies make a good HID conversion setup that actually works well? I've heard that many of the kits that you see today look brighter but don't actually let you see farther; in some cases they supposedly lessen your field of view.

Just know that you pretty much have to do the conversion that was shown in the thread he posted. You get the projection lenses out of an Acura TSX or something. Im sure anything small enough to fit would work just fine. But I say this cause I have a friend that did it without them... his lights are no brighter than my stockers are on bright. Kinda pointless. He is going to have to do the conversion later.
